>>>>>>> There can be only one PLZA configuration in a system. The values in
>>>>>>> the MSR_IA32_PQR_PLZA_ASSOC register (RMID, RMID_EN, CLOSID,
>>>>>>> CLOSID_EN) must be identical across all logical processors. The only
>>>>>>> field that may differ is PLZA_EN.

>>>>>>> I was initially unsure which RMID should be used when PLZA is
>>>>>>> enabled on MON groups.
>>>>>>>
>>>>>>> After re-evaluating, enabling PLZA on MON groups is still feasible:
>>>>>>>
>>>>>>> 1. Only one group in the system can have PLZA enabled.
>>>>>>> 2. If PLZA is enabled on CTRL_MON group then we cannot enable PLZA
>>>>>>> on MON group.
>>>>>>> 3. If PLZA is enabled on the CTRL_MON group, then the CLOSID and
>>>>>>> RMID of the CTRL_MON group can be written.
>>>>>>> 4. If PLZA is enabled on a MON group, then the CLOSID of the
>>>>>>> CTRL_MON group can be used, while the RMID of the MON group can be
>>>>>>> written.

>> Not quite.
>> When you enter the kernel, you want to run unthrottled to avoid
>> priority inversion situations.
In cases where you want to reserve a cache region for one program you
may want to avoid giving the kernel access to that region so it doesn't
pollute it.
>> But at the same time, you still want to be able to monitor the
>> bandwidth for your thread or job, i..e, keep the same
>> RMID you have in user space.
>
> Thanks for sharing your usecase.
>
>>
>> The kernel is by construction shared by all threads running in the
>> system. It should run unrestricted or with the
>> bandwidth allocated to the highest priority tasks.
>>
>> PLZA should not change the RMID at all.
>
> Would the above with RMID_EN=0 give you this usecase?
>
> Unfortunately, this isn't possible when rmid/pmg is scoped to
> closid/partid as is the case in MPAM, i.e. the monitors require a match
> on the pair (closid, partid). Hence, I think we need to support the case
> where both RMID and CLOSID change.
